Q: Is 1,710,202 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 1,710,202 is a composite number.

Why is 1,710,202 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 1,710,202 can be evenly divided by 1 2 13 26 65,777 131,554 855,101 and 1,710,202, with no remainder.

Since 1,710,202 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,710,202, it is a composite number.
